At some point the Wachowskis decided that they want to thematically color the 2 realms. Matrix = Green, Real world = Blue. IIRC this is specifically mentioned in the extras on the Matrix digibook edition blu. Unlike some of the folks here, I don't remember how it was theatrically (and whether the early DVD's were faithful to that scheme).

I don't recall there being a blue tint to the real world in the Blu-Ray. I remember it as simply being normal, as it should be. I'll have to play it and have another look. Remember also that tungsten film or normal blue filtration to counteract tungsten lighting could be giving that effect, and not that it was intentionally tinted blue for it's own sake.

I did look at the capsaholic comparison and the difference between the non-tinted DVD and the Blu-Ray is stark. It would be interesting to view that DVD version. The contrast is better in that version, where it is not overdone like in the Blu-Ray with it's much darker and crushed shadows and plenty of blown highlights.

Great, it looks like I may now be buying that DVD version and getting angry about the Blu-Ray I have, and not because of the tint but because of the contrast difference.

Edit: I'm looking at the Blu-Ray version now and the real world is not tinted at all. The blue you see is some scene elements and simply the look of film once corrected for tungsten lighting. In other words the typical blue we have always associated with night time scenes of movies from the past. Digital cameras also produce that same blue once tungsten lighting is corrected for. Of course it can be digitally removed in software to produce what our eyes see but that blue look is now a tradition.
